Aims and Scopes
- Cervantine Literature Analysis:
The journal emphasizes critical examinations of Cervantes' texts, particularly *Don Quixote*, exploring themes, narrative techniques, and character studies. - Cultural and Historical Contextualization:
Papers often delve into the historical and cultural backdrop of Cervantes' time, assessing how these elements influence his works and their reception. - Interdisciplinary Approaches:
The journal encourages submissions that integrate perspectives from various fields such as literary theory, history, philosophy, and the arts, fostering a rich dialogue across disciplines. - Reception Studies:
There is a consistent focus on the reception of Cervantes' works in different cultures and time periods, including adaptations and translations, which highlight the global impact of his literature. - Comparative Literature:
The journal often features comparative studies that relate Cervantine themes to other literary traditions, expanding the discourse around his influence beyond Spanish literature.
Trending and Emerging
- Contemporary Adaptations and Reception:
There is an increasing trend towards analyzing contemporary adaptations of Cervantes' works, particularly *Don Quixote*, in various media, reflecting its relevance in today’s cultural landscape. - Intersections of Literature and Other Disciplines:
Emerging themes show a growing interest in the intersections of Cervantine literature with fields such as ecocriticism, music, and visual arts, indicating a broadening of the journal's scope. - Feminist Readings and Gender Studies:
Recent publications have begun to explore feminist interpretations and gender dynamics within Cervantes' works, indicating a trend towards addressing contemporary social issues through historical texts. - Global Perspectives on Cervantes:
There is a noticeable increase in studies that examine Cervantes' impact and reception in non-Spanish speaking cultures, suggesting a trend towards a more global understanding of his literary legacy.
Declining or Waning
- Traditional Textual Criticism:
There appears to be a waning focus on traditional textual criticism of *Don Quixote*, as scholars increasingly favor broader thematic analyses and interdisciplinary approaches. - Historical Biographies of Cervantes:
Papers dedicated solely to biographical studies of Cervantes have become less frequent, indicating a shift towards more thematic and analytical discussions rather than purely historical accounts. - Narrow Interpretations of Cervantine Humor:
Interpretations centered solely on humor in Cervantes' works are declining, as the discourse expands to encompass more complex emotional and psychological dimensions in his narratives. - Localized Studies:
Research focusing exclusively on localized or regional studies of Cervantes' work, such as specific geographic influences, has diminished in favor of broader, more universal themes.
